Vivian Xuyan Liu

3×3 · top 9.2% of 284,439 all-time · competing since December 2018 · 2018LIUV01

Vivian Xuyan Liu has been competing for 8 years. Her best event is the 3×3: a personal-best single of 10.59, set at UCSD Winter 2023, puts her in the top 9.2% of the 284,439 people who have ever been ranked in the event, and 5,049th in the United States. Until August 2006, no official 3×3 solve in the world had been that fast. Across 4 competitions since December 2018, she has put 50 official solves on the record across four events. Solve to solve, her 3×3 times vary about 15% around a typical one, an early reading from 6 counted rounds. Her 3×3 best has come down from 17.29 in December 2018 to 10.59, a 39% improvement. Vivian has entered four competitions, more competitions than 78% of everyone who has ever competed.
